Съдържание
Този път решихме да ви предоставим най-простите функции на Google Sheets, които непременно трябва да научите. Те не само ще ви помогнат при обикновените изчисления, но и ще допринесат за разширяване на знанията ви за изграждане на формули в Google Sheets.
Как да създавате формули в Google Sheets
Каквато и статия за формулите в Google Sheets да съм виждал, всички те започват с обяснение на два основни аспекта: какво е функция и какво е формула. За щастие, вече сме разгледали това в специално начално ръководство за формулите в Google Sheets. Освен това то хвърля известна светлина върху препратките към клетките и различните оператори. Ако все още не сте я видели, крайно време е да я разгледате.
В друга наша статия споделяме всичко, което трябва да знаете, за да можете да добавяте първите си формули в Google Sheets, да правите препратки към други клетки и листове или да копирате формули в колоната.
След като се справите с тях, няма да имате проблеми с използването на варианти на основните функции на Google Sheets, описани по-долу.
12 най-полезни функции на Google Sheets
За никого не е тайна, че в електронните таблици има десетки функции, всяка от които е със свои собствени характеристики и със свое собствено предназначение. Но това не означава, че не знаете нищо за електронните таблици, ако не владеете всички тях.
Съществува малък набор от функции на Google Sheets, които ще ви позволят да издържите достатъчно дълго, без да се ровите в електронни таблици. Позволете ми да ви ги представя.
Съвет. Ако задачата ви е изключително сложна и основните формули на Google Sheets не са това, което търсите, разгледайте нашата колекция от бързи инструменти - Power Tools.
Функция SUM в Google Таблици
Това е една от онези функции на Google Sheets, които трябва да научите по един или друг начин. Тя сумира няколко числа и/или клетки и връща общата им сума:
=SUM(стойност1, [стойност2, ...])- стойност1 Това може да бъде число, клетка с число или дори диапазон от клетки с числа. Този аргумент е задължителен.
- value2, ... - всички други числа и/или клетки с числа, които искате да добавите към стойност1 . Квадратните скоби подсказват, че този елемент не е задължителен. В този конкретен случай той може да се повтори няколко пъти.
Съвет. Можете да намерите функциите сред стандартните инструменти в лентата с инструменти на Google Sheets:
Мога да създавам различни формули SUM в Google Sheets като тези:
=SUM(2,6)
да изчислите две числа (броя на кивитата за мен)
=SUM(2,4,6,8,10)
за изчисляване на няколко числа
=SUM(B2:B6)
за сумиране на няколко клетки в обхвата
Съвет. Има един трик, който функцията ви позволява да направите, за да добавите бързо клетки в Google Sheets в колона или ред. Опитайте се да въведете функцията SUM точно под колоната, която искате да сумирате, или вдясно от интересуващия ви ред. Ще видите как тя веднага предлага правилния диапазон:
Вижте също:
- Как да съберете редовете в електронни таблици на Google
COUNT & COUNTA
Тази двойка функции на Google Sheets ще ви позволи да разберете колко клетки с различно съдържание съдържа вашият диапазон. Единствената разлика между тях е, че COUNT в Google Sheets работи само с цифрови клетки, докато COUNTA брои и клетки с текст.
Така че, за да съберете всички клетки само с числа, използвайте COUNT за Google Sheets:
=COUNT(стойност1, [стойност2, ...])- стойност1 е първата стойност или обхват, които се проверяват.
- стойност2 - други стойности или диапазони, които да се използват за броене. Както ви казах преди, квадратните скоби означават, че функцията може да мине без стойност2 .
Ето формулата, която имам:
=COUNT(B2:B7)
Ако искам да получа всички поръчки с известен статус, ще трябва да използвам друга функция: COUNTA за Google Sheets. Тя преброява всички непразни клетки: клетки с текст, числа, дати, булеви стойности - каквото се сетите.
=COUNTA(стойност1, [стойност2, ...])Упражнението с неговите аргументи е същото: стойност1 и стойност2 представляват стойности или диапазони, които се обработват, стойност2 а следните не са задължителни.
Забележете разликата:
=COUNTA(B2:B7)
COUNTA в Google Sheets взема предвид всички клетки със съдържание, независимо дали са с числа или не.
Вижте също:
- Google Таблици COUNT и COUNTA - подробно ръководство за функциите с примери
SUMIF & COUNTIF
Докато SUM, COUNT и COUNTA изчисляват всички записи, които им подавате, SUMIF и COUNTIF в Google Sheets обработват тези клетки, които отговарят на определени изисквания. Частите на формулата ще бъдат следните:
=COUNTIF(обхват, критерий)- обхват да се брои - задължително
- критерий да се обмисли преброяване - необходимо
- обхват за търсене на стойности, свързани с критерия - изисква се
- критерий за кандидатстване в диапазона - изисква се
- sum_range - диапазонът, от който да се сумират записите, ако се различава от първия диапазон - по избор
Например, мога да разбера броя на поръчките, които изостават от графика:
=COUNTIF(B2:B7, "late")
Или мога да получа само общото количество киви:
=SUMIF(A2:A6, "Киви",B2:B6)
Вижте също:
- Google Spreadsheet COUNTIF - пребройте дали клетките съдържат определен текст
- Преброяване на клетките по цвят в Google Sheets
- Използване на COUNTIF за маркиране на дубликати в Google Sheets
- SUMIF в Google Sheets - условно сумиране на клетки в електронни таблици
- SUMIFS в Google Sheets - сумиране на клетки с множество критерии (логика AND / OR)
Функция AVERAGE в Google Таблици
В математиката средната стойност е сумата на всички числа, разделена на техния брой. Тук, в Google Sheets, функцията AVERAGE прави същото: тя оценява целия диапазон и намира средната стойност на всички числа, като игнорира текста.
=AVERAGE(стойност1, [стойност2, ...])Можете да въведете няколко стойности и/или диапазони, които да разгледате.
Ако артикулът е наличен за покупка в различни магазини на различни цени, можете да съберете средната цена:
=СРЕДНА СТОЙНОСТ(B2:B6)
Функции MAX и MIN в Google Sheets
Имената на тези миниатюрни функции говорят сами за себе си.
Използвайте функцията MIN на Google Sheets, за да върнете минималното число от диапазона:
=MIN(B2:B6)
Съвет: За да намерите най-малкия брой нули, поставете вътре функцията IF:
=MIN(IF($B$2:$B$60,$B$2:$B$6))
Използвайте функцията MAX на Google Sheets, за да върнете максималното число от обхвата:
=MAX(B2:B6)
Съвет. Искате ли да игнорирате нулите и тук? Няма проблем. Просто добавете още един IF:
=MAX(IF($B$2:$B$60,$B$2:$B$6))
Лесно, лесно, с изстискан лимон :)
Функцията IF на Google Sheets
Въпреки че функцията IF в Google Sheets е доста популярна и често използвана, по някои причини тя продължава да обърква и озадачава потребителите си. Нейната основна цел е да ви помогне да разработите условия и съответно да върнете различни резултати. Тя често се нарича и формулата "IF/THEN" в Google Sheets.
=IF(logical_expression, value_if_true, value_if_false)- logical_expression е самото условие, което има два възможни логически резултата: TRUE или FALSE.
- value_if_true е всичко, което искате да се върне, ако условието е изпълнено (TRUE).
- в противен случай, когато не е изпълнена (FALSE), value_if_false се връща.
Ето един обикновен пример: оценявам оценки от обратна връзка. Ако броят на получените оценки е по-малък от 5, искам да ги обознача като беден . Но ако оценката е по-голяма от 5, трябва да видя добър . Ако преведа това на езика на електронните таблици, ще получа необходимата формула:
=IF(A6<5,"poor","good")
Вижте също:
- Подробности за функцията IF в Google Sheets
И, ИЛИ
Тези две функции са чисто логически.
Функцията AND на електронната таблица на Google проверява дали всички негови стойности са логически правилни, докато функцията OR на Google Sheets - ако всеки в противен случай и двете ще върнат FALSE.
Честно казано, не си спомням да съм ги използвал много самостоятелно. Но и двете се използват в други функции и формули, особено във функцията IF за Google Sheets.
Като добавям функцията AND на Google Sheets към условието си, мога да проверявам оценките в две колони. Ако и двете числа са по-големи или равни на 5, отбелязвам общата заявка като "добра", а в противен случай - като "слаба":
=IF(AND(A2>=5,B2>=5),"good","poor")
Но също така мога да променя условието и да маркирам състоянието добър ако поне едно от двете числа е по-голямо или равно на 5. Функцията OR на Google Sheets ще ви помогне:
=IF(OR(A2>=5,B2>=5),"good","poor")
CONCATENATE в Google Sheets
Ако трябва да обедините записи от няколко клетки в една, без да губите данни, трябва да използвате функцията CONCATENATE на Google Sheets:
=CONCATENATE(string1, [string2, ...])Каквито и символи, думи или препратки към други клетки да дадете на формулата, тя ще върне всичко в една клетка:
=CONCATENATE(A2,B2)
Функцията ви позволява също така да разделяте комбинираните записи с избрани от вас знаци, като например по следния начин:
=CONCATENATE(A2,", ",B2)
Вижте също:
- Функция CONCATENATE с примери за формули
Функцията TRIM на Google Sheets
Можете бързо да проверите диапазона за допълнителни интервали с помощта на функцията TRIM:
=TRIM(текст)Въведете самия текст или препратка към клетка с текст. Функцията ще го разгледа и не само ще изреже всички водещи и следващи интервали, но и ще намали броя им между думите до едно:
ДНЕС & СЕГА
Ако работите с ежедневни отчети или се нуждаете от днешната дата и текущото време в електронните си таблици, функциите TODAY и NOW са на ваше разположение.
С тяхна помощ ще вмъкнете днешните формули за дата и час в Google Sheets и те ще се актуализират винаги, когато имате достъп до документа. Наистина не мога да си представя по-проста функция от тези две:
=ДНЕС()
ще ви покаже днешната дата.=NOW()
ще върне както днешната дата, така и текущото време.
Вижте също:
- Изчисляване на време в Google Sheets - изваждане, сумиране и извличане на единици за дата и време
Функция DATE в Google Таблици
Ако ще работите с дати в електронни таблици, функцията DATE на Google Sheets е задължителна за усвояване.
Когато изграждате различни формули, рано или късно ще забележите, че не всички от тях разпознават датите, въведени във вида, в който са: 12/8/2019.
Освен това локалът на електронната таблица определя формата на датата. Така че форматът, с който сте свикнали (като 12/8/2019 в САЩ) може да не бъде разпознат от списъците на други потребители (например при локала за Обединеното кралство, където датите изглеждат като 8/12/2019 ).
За да избегнете това, е препоръчително да използвате функцията DATE. Тя преобразува въведените от вас ден, месец и година във формат, който Google винаги ще разбира:
=DATE(година, месец, ден)Например, ако трябва да извадя 7 дни от рождения ден на моя приятел, за да знам кога да започна да се подготвям, ще използвам следната формула:
=DATE(2019,9,17)-7
Или мога да направя така, че функцията DATE да връща петия ден от текущия месец и година:
=DATE(ГОДИНА(ДНЕС()),МЕСЕЦ(ДНЕС()),5)
Вижте също:
- Дата и час в Google Sheets - въвеждане, форматиране и конвертиране на дати и час в листа
- Функция DATEDIF в Google Sheets - изчисляване на дни, месеци и години между две дати в Google Sheets
Google Таблици VLOOKUP
И накрая, функцията VLOOKUP. Същата тази функция, която кара много потребители на Google Sheets да изпитват ужас :) Но истината е, че е необходимо да я разбиете само веднъж - и няма да помните как сте живели без нея.
Google Sheets VLOOKUP сканира една колона от таблицата в търсене на посочен от вас запис и извлича съответната стойност от друга колона от същия ред:
=VLOOKUP(search_key, range, index, [is_sorted])- search_key е стойността, която трябва да се търси
- обхват е таблицата, в която трябва да търсите
- индекс е номерът на колоната, от която ще се изтеглят свързаните записи.
- is_sorted не е задължителна и се използва за подсказване, че колоната, която се сканира, е сортирана
Имам таблица с плодове и искам да знам колко струват портокалите. За тази цел създавам формула, която ще търси Orange в първата колона на моята таблица и да върне съответната цена от третата колона:
=VLOOKUP("Orange",A1:C6,3)
Вижте също:
- Подробно ръководство за VLOOKUP в електронни таблици с примери
- Улавяне и отстраняване на грешки във VLOOKUP
Бързо модифициране на множество формули в Google Sheets със специален инструмент
Разполагаме и с инструмент, който ви помага да променяте едновременно няколко формули на Google Sheets в рамките на избрания диапазон. Нарича се "Формули". Нека ви покажа как работи.
Имам малка таблица, в която използвах функциите SUMIF, за да намеря общата стойност на всеки плод:
Искам да умножа всички общи суми по 3, за да попълня запасите. Затова избирам колоната с моите формули и отварям добавката.
Забележка. Тъй като инструментът е част от Power Tools, първо трябва да го инсталирате. Ще намерите инструмента в долната част на прозореца:
След това избирам опцията да Промяна на всички избрани формули , добавете *3 в края на извадката на формулата и щракнете върху Изпълнявайте . Можете да видите как общите суми се променят съответно - всичко това наведнъж:
Надявам се, че тази статия е отговорила на някои от въпросите ви за функциите в Google Sheets. Ако имате предвид други формули в Google Sheets, които не са разгледани тук, споделете ги в коментарите по-долу.